Revelstoke
The natural beauty of Revelstoke (population: 7,230) captivates visitors year-round. Hike or camp amidst the rugged expanse of Mount Revelstoke and Glacier National Parks. Fish freshwater lakes, paddle fast-flowing rivers or enjoy countless recreation opportunities in the area's three provincial parks. Revelstoke itself has plenty of scenic hiking trails and an extensive mountain bike trail network.
Nearby, restore body and spirit in the area's three mineral hot springs. Or visit Craigellachie to see where Donald Smith struck the Last Spike, forging Canada's first transcontinental railway, then head to the Revelstoke Railway Museum. Don't miss the Revelstoke Dam, one of North America's largest hydroelectric developments.
Winter brings great alpine and cross-country skiing, as well as snowmobiling, cat-skiing, heli-skiing and ice fishing.
